Mechanism of Action

Skin moisturization is related to the barrier function of the Stratum corneum, which governs skin's water kinetics: balance between water diffusion through the Stratum corneum and evaporation, its flow value and its sequestration.
CARICILINE® simultaneously provides 3 families of molecules: polysaccharides, free sugars component of the NMF (Natural Moisturizing Factor) and malic acid, which contributes to trans-epidermal water loss regulation.

Scientific Process

With age, the skin dries, it becomes more sensitive to inflammation, loses its plasticity and becomes rough.
CARICILINE® offers three times more acid oses such as galaturonic acid, which limits trans-epidermal water loss, free sugars making up the NMF, which trap water in the Stratum corneum, forming moisturization complexes, and malic acid, which induces keratin catabolism, restoring skin's suppleness and elasticity. Holding filmogenic substances and hygroscopic components capable of slowing the rate of water evaporation, CARICILINE® maintains the integrity of the Stratum corneum by regulating trans-epidermal water loss.
